The National Institute of Sports, Physical Education, and Recreation, along with the University of Physical Culture and Sports Sciences, invites you to participate in the XI INTERNATIONAL CONVENTION ON PHYSICAL ACTIVITY AND SPORTS (AFIDE 2025). 

Themes to be developed:

  • Biomedical, Physiological, Psychological, and Social Sciences or others applied to Physical Education, Physical Activity, Recreation, and Sports.
  • Sports Engineering, Artificial Intelligence, and other emerging technologies applied to Physical Education, Physical Activity, Recreation, and Sports.
  • Continuing education for professionals in Physical Education, Physical Activity, Physical Recreation, and Sports.
  • Management and direction of Physical Education, Physical Activity, Physical Recreation, and Sports.
  • Information and Communication Technologies applied to Physical Education, Physical Activity, Physical Recreation, and Sports.
  • Physical Recreation, leisure time, and quality of life.
  • Physical Education.
  • Therapeutic and preventive physical activity.
  • Theory and Methodology of Sports Training

Presentation Modalities: 

Each submitted work must be headed by the general information of the authors, including first and last name, scientific degree or academic title, institution of origin, country, email address, and ORCID code (up to four), indicating with *, the one related to participation in the submitted work. Accompany the work with a letter of originality..

Poster Presentation:

The posters or banners in digital format (PowerPoint, PDF, and/or JPG). Arial at 34 points. Include: Title, Full names of authors and co-authors, Institutions, Introduction, Objective, Method, Results (May include tables and/or figures, photos, and images necessary to effectively communicate your work). Conclusions and updated References.

Presentation of the Papers:

The works must be original. Title: a maximum of 12 words. Summary: up to 200 words in a single paragraph. (Spanish and English). Keywords: at least three. Introduction. (1 page). Materials and methods: based on data. (2 to 3 pages). Development: Detailed analysis of the contributions. (3 pages). Conclusions and recommendations: Directly related to the title, objective, and results of the work. (1 page). References and bibliography: in accordance with APA Seventh Edition guidelines. (1 page). Maximum 10 pages, letter size, Word format, Arial 12 font, justified, one and a half line spacing.

Video Presentation: 

Along with your 10-page paper, you must submit a capsule in MP4 format where you present: the problem solved, how you did it, the result, and the impact. It must not exceed 3 minutes and 25 MB in size, discussing the main results of your work.
